Myth #1

Online courses are easier than face-to-face courses

Online courses are often more demanding and take more time than traditional face-to-face courses. Since the majority of the content and interaction in an online course is done through written word, students must proactively interact with the content delivered to them; be able to effectively communicate in writing with their instructor and their peers; and have superb time management skills. In an online course, students are responsible for their own learning and for keeping on task. So, while the content delivered and the learning outcomes of an online course section may be identical to its face-to-face counterpart, the method of delivery often adds an additional level of difficulty that an unprepared student may find problematic.
